What starts out for T.R. Lawrence as a surfing vacation to Morocco turns into a series of life-changing adventures–stemming from such random events as a knock on the door, the casual flipping through a magazine, a duffle bag knocked off a shoulder, a walk through a Marrakech alley when suddenly being pulled into a shop, and a motorcycle ride behind a truck loaded with olives. His fascinating work of storytelling details his courage to pursue new opportunities. You’ll appreciate T.R.‘s excitement when he buys ten exquisite hand-woven rugs during his first trip and finds a buyer in the States. T.R. shares the joy of stepping into a business that quickly becomes an adventurous lifestyle he is destined to live.

His narrative writing covers his 25-year successful import-export business, with the partnership of his wife, Linda, and the assistance of local merchants, as he gathers the best antiques and things rarer and finer than what unknowledgeable tourists can find. T.R. and Linda embrace the culture and customs of Moroccans, adopting their clothing styles as their own.

He takes you into the street markets and alleyways in the old section of the city, as well as the intriguing Djemaa el Fna, the Square of the Dead. Become enthralled with the acrobats, snake charmers, and storytellers that enliven the square each evening across from their hotel. T.R. frequently feels that Marrakech is speaking to him, convincing him he belongs there.

Travelers will celebrate each page in T.R.’s journeys within the country and through the realm of art and cultural activities discovered in his hunt for exquisite rug weavings by hand, jewelry, antiques, and clothing in the street markets for export to the United States. In his own prosperity, T.R. naturally helps many merchants thrive as they go out in search of rarities for him. Welcomed and respected by the business community, he creates and fosters relationships lasting decades.

Enjoy T.R.’s vivid details and fascinating cultural experiences of a country vastly different from what we know in the West–exotic, ancient, colorful, and rich in sights and sounds.
